We had a windy yet incredibly insightful Heavy Chef session in Cape Town last night with Joe Botha from Trustfabric and Tim Shier from Brandseye. Trust and Identity online has become more and more of an issue with social networking, micro blogging and the vast amount of information available on the Internet today.
Joe kicked things off talking about Privacy, Trust and VRM.
Vendor Relationship Management software refers to the opposit of CRM which is the relationship from the consumer to the vendor and creating a feedback cycle conversation.
Moreover, Joe dicussed the effects of the Protection if Personal Information Act and the Consumer Protection Act on your information online as the consumer.
Next up, Tim took the stage explaining social media in sociological terms. Tim explained how in social media you have two sides: the In-group and the Out-group. Brands need to create a strong in-group to protect their reputation through difficult times.
Tim dived into examples of brands over-promising and the not delivering and the implications they face via their fans online. According to Tim the more consumers love your brand, the harder you can fall.
